Bafana Bafana head coach Hugo Broos believes South Africa can still secure a place in the FIFA World Cup knockout stages after their spirited display against Czechia.

South Africa keep their World cup hopes alive after claiming a 1-1 draw against Czechia in their second Group A fixture.

After falling behind to an early Czechia goal in the fifth minute, Bafana Bafana battled their way back into the contest, with Teboho Mokoena’s composed penalty eight minutes from time earning South Africa a hard-fought 1-1 draw.

South Africa’s FIFA World Cup fate will be decided in their final Group A encounter against Korea Republic at Estadio BBVA in Guadalupe on 25 June 2026, with a place in the knockout stages still within reach.

Broos insists the display reflected the true identity of the national team as they continue their push for a place in the World Cup knockout stages.

“If we can make another performance like today, I think we have a chance to go in the second round,” added Broos.

“I’m very proud of my team, and this is the real Bafana Bafana.”
